Don Pedro Pablo Chuc Pech

Don Pedro PabloPedro Pablo Chuc Pech is a member of the Mayan Council of Elders and a retired Primary School teacher.  His current work involves preserving Mayan culture and language for students of his pueblo.  To that end he has formed The Academy of Mayan Culture where is teaching Yucatec Maya, writing in Yucatec Maya, the Mayan Calendar, Mayan numbers and elementary hieroglyphic writing. 

He has written books for his Mayan pupils and has collaborated with Mr. Christian Rasmussen of Denmark on several topics of the Mayan Oral tradition.

He is an active participant in natives' meetings with the “Continental Council of Elders and Gurus of America.”  He is also a sought after conference presenter on the Mayan culture in general having presented at conferences in Finland, France. Germany, and the United States.

 

 

Alfred Rordame

Alfred Rordamehas taught yogic meditation and philosophy for many years and is an American College of Vedic Astrology certified Jyotishi (vedic astrologer).  Since moving to the Yucatán in 2005, he has undertaken a study of Mayan calendrics, archeoastronomy, the Mayan language and the foundations of Mayan Spirituality and Cosmology.  An accomplished musician and 20-year student of Indian music, Alfred intuits through sound and symbology.  Owner of Hotel Macan ché with his wife Emily, he is also adept at negotiating the niceties of Yucatecan travel.
